Pop-up office, Stand 214, Larkspur Expo Hall, 12–15 March. Team assistants: arrive by 07:30 each day. Stock the back cabin with lanyards, demo tablets, and the Fenbright brochures before doors open. Lock laptops in the cabin whenever the stand is unstaffed — no exceptions. Couriers deliver to the east loading bay; collect items yourself, nothing left at the stand. End of day: power down screens, bag the lead scanner, secure the cabin. The cabin keypad takes the code below.

staff pass of kawip-hawef = bdg-QLP-2

Vendor note: Brightlark Systems wants us to enable permessage-deflate on their Pulsegate websocket feed. Heads up for review: compression cuts bandwidth roughly 60% on their chatty telemetry frames, but their own docs admit CPU spikes on small messages and sketchy proxy support. I'd suggest we enable it only for payloads over 1 KB and benchmark before signing the renewal. If you want the raw numbers from their trial, reach out to their integration desk.

escalation mailbox, yajeg-bageg: quenax.olidor@lumiccorp.internal

**Mgmt Meeting Minutes — Retiring the Brightline Range**

Quick recap for sales leads at Fenholt Supplies: we agreed to retire the Brightline fixture range by year-end. Remaining stock moves to clearance pricing next month, and accounts on standing orders get migrated to the Lumetta range. Trade-in incentives were approved in principle. The confidential note on next steps sits just below.

board note of bajof-bajeg: The pricing group signed off on a budget of $13.4 million for Project Sildor. The renewal with Lamixek Holdings closes at $48.9 million a year, 49 percent above the last contract.